Salalah: A two-day conference on "The Future of Logistics in the Age of Artificial Intelligence (AI)" began today at the Sultan Qaboos Youth Compound for Culture and Entertainment in Salalah. The event is organized by the National Academy for Training and Development in collaboration with the Dhofar branch of Oman Chamber of Commerce and Industry.

The conference program featured three papers. The first was titled "Modern Technologies in the Logistics Sector," the second focused on "Artificial Intelligence in the Logistics Sector," and the third discussed "Modern Services at the Salalah Free Zone."

Two panel discussions were also held, covering integrated work in the logistics sector and digital transformation in supply chains, with a focus on AI, digital systems, and logistics systems.

The second day of the program will include two workshops: "The Contribution of AI to Managerial Decision-Making in Supply Chains" and "Leading the Future: AI in the Service of Institutions."

The conference aims to highlight the role of AI in improving the efficiency of supply chains and transportation, promoting sustainability, and supporting Oman Vision 2040 through a vital sector for economic diversification. It also seeks to facilitate the exchange of expertise between the public and private sectors and explore areas for joint cooperation.
